Coding Style

+ +

+Mesa's code style has changed over the years. Here's the latest. +

+ +

+Comment your code! It's extremely important that open-source code be +well documented. Also, strive to write clean, easily understandable code. +

+ +

+3-space indentation +

+ +

+If you use tabs, set them to 8 columns +

+ +

+Brace example: +

+
+	if (condition) {
+	   foo;
+	}
+	else {
+	   bar;
+	}
+
+ +

+Here's the GNU indent command which will best approximate my preferred style: +

+
+	indent -br -i3 -npcs infile.c -o outfile.c
+
+ + +

+Local variable name example: localVarName (no underscores) +

+ +

+Constants and macros are ALL_UPPERCASE, with _ between words +

+ +

+Global vars not allowed. +

+ +

+Function name examples: +

+
+	glFooBar()       - a public GL entry point (in dispatch.c)
+	_mesa_FooBar()   - the internal immediate mode function
+	save_FooBar()    - retained mode (display list) function in dlist.c
+	foo_bar()        - a static (private) function
+	_mesa_foo_bar()  - an internal non-static Mesa function
+

Making a New Mesa Release

+ +

+These are the instructions for making a new Mesa release. +

+ +

+Prerequisites (later versions may work): +

+ + +

+Be sure to do a "cvs update -d ." in the Mesa directory to +get all the latest files. +

+ +

+Update the version definitions in src/version.h +

+ +

+Create/edit the docs/RELNOTES-X.Y file to document what's new in the release. +Edit the docs/VERSIONS file too. +

+ +

+Edit Make-config and change the MESA_MAJOR and/or MESA_MINOR versions. +

+ +

+Edit the GNU configure stuff to change versions numbers as needed: +Update the version string (second argument) in the line +"AM_INIT_AUTOMAKE(Mesa, 3.3)" in the configure.in file. +

+ +

+Remove the leading `dnl' from the line "dnl AM_MAINTAINER_MODE". +

+ +

+Verify the version numbers near the top of configure.in +

+ +

+Run "fixam -f" to disable automatic dependency tracking. +

+ +

+Run the bootstrap script to generate the configure script. +

+ +

+Edit Makefile.X11 and verify DIRECTORY is set correctly. The Mesa +sources must be in that directory (or there must be a symbolic link). +

+ +

+Edit Makefile.X11 and verify that LIB_NAME and DEMO_NAME are correct. +If it's a beta release, be sure the bump up the beta release number. +

+ +

+cp Makefile.X11 to Makefile so that the old-style Mesa makefiles +still work. ./configure will overwrite it if that's what the user runs. +

+ +

+Make a symbolic link from $(DIRECTORY) to Mesa. For example, +ln -s Mesa Mesa-3.3 This is needed in order to make a correct +tar file in the next step. +

+ +

+Make the distribution files. From inside the Mesa directory: +

+	make -f Makefile.X11 lib_tar
+	make -f Makefile.X11 demo_tar
+	make -f Makefile.X11 lib_zip
+	make -f Makefile.X11 demo_zip
+
+ +

+Copy the distribution files to a temporary directory, unpack them, +compile everything, and run some demos to be sure everything works. +

+ +

+Upload the *.tar.gz and *.zip files to ftp.mesa3d.org +

+ +

+Update the web site. +

+ +

+Make an announcement on the mailing lists: +mesa3d-dev@lists.sf.net, +mesa3d-users@lists.sf.net +and +mesa3d-announce@lists.sf.net +

Autoconf info

+ +

+In order to run the bootstrap script you'll need: +

+

+autoconf 2.50
+automake 1.4-p5
+libtool 1.4
